What is 98/52 Divided By 8/7

Answer: 9852÷87\frac{98}{52}\div\frac{8}{7} = 343208\frac{343}{208}

Solving 9852÷87\frac{98}{52}\div\frac{8}{7}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

9852÷87=9852×78\frac{98}{52} \div \frac{8}{7} = \frac{98}{52} \times \frac{7}{8}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 98×7=68698 \times 7 = 686
  • Multiply the Denominators: 52×8=41652 \times 8 = 416
  • Form the New Fraction: 9852×87=686416\frac{98}{52} \times \frac{8}{7} = \frac{686}{416}

Let's Simplify 686416\frac{686}{416}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 686686 and 416416. The GCD of 686686 and 416416 is 22.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:686÷2416÷2=343208\frac{686 \div 2}{416 \div 2} = \frac{343}{208}

Answer 9852÷87=343208\frac{98}{52}\div\frac{8}{7} = \frac{343}{208}
